Pineapple Tattoo All Meanings – [Explained]

The pineapple is a popular fruit and has been used as a symbol for centuries. The most common meaning of the pineapple tattoo is hospitality.

This is because the fruit is often used as a hostess gift, or given to guests as a welcome gesture. The pineapple is also a symbol of wealth and prosperity, due to its rarity and cost.

For these reasons, the pineapple tattoo can represent different things to different people. Whether you see it as a sign of hospitality or prosperity, the pineapple tattoo is sure to be a unique and stylish addition to your body art collection.

Pineapple tattoo meaning for men

A pineapple tattoo on a man can symbolize a number of things. It can be a sign of hospitality, as the fruit is often associated with welcome and warmth.

It can also represent strength and fortitude, as the pineapple is known to be a tough fruit. And finally, it can be a symbol of abundance and good fortune, as pineapples are often seen as symbols of wealth and prosperity.
